MM2 on Roblox and why it still pulls in millions

Murder Mystery 2 remains one of the most resilient hits on Roblox. The premise is simple and readable. One player is the murderer, one is the sheriff, and everyone else is an innocent trying to survive. What keeps players returning year after year is not only the rules of a single round but the rhythm that surrounds it. Short matches create constant decision points, cosmetics and trading add long term goals, and steady events refresh habits without erasing learned skills. The result is a social loop that works for quick sessions and for long progression grinds alike.

A core loop that never grows old

Each round delivers a clean triangle of incentives. Murderer wants stealth and timing, sheriff wants deduction and accuracy, innocents want survival and information. This triangle generates different stories on small maps, large maps, and holiday maps without demanding new mechanics every month. Matches end quickly, so bad decisions do not feel punishing, and clutch wins feel earned. That cadence is ideal for Roblox where many players hop between games and want satisfying outcomes in minutes rather than hours.

Social tension that rewards communication

MM2 is as much a conversation game as it is an aim game. Voice or chat can bait reactions, misdirect suspicions, and encourage team play that is not formally required. Younger players learn soft skills like reading intent while veterans practice trickery and calm positioning. The lobby between rounds serves as a social plaza where groups reform, trade items, and compare strategies. Because the rules are easy to explain, new friends can join without friction, which supports long term community growth.

Seasonal events that refresh the meta

Holiday events inject fresh maps, limited items, and small twists that reshape priorities. The fundamentals remain steady, so players keep their skill confidence, yet the reward table and visual themes feel new. Event windows create shared goals that pull lapsed players back in and give newcomers a reason to stick around. This pattern mirrors live service best practices across the industry, scaled to the lighter footprint of Roblox sessions.

Skill expression that fits all ages

Success in MM2 rests on knowledge of map angles, movement routes, and tells in player behavior. Aiming matters, but awareness and patience matter more. That balance lets beginners contribute to wins while giving veterans enough ceiling to distinguish themselves. The sheriff’s role in particular turns into a study of timing and restraint, while the murderer learns pathing and crowd manipulation. The game rewards learning without forcing players to study complex tech, which widens its appeal.

Content creation that multiplies reach

MM2 is a reliable engine for short form video and streaming. Rounds are compact, outcomes are surprising, and inventories provide easy flex moments. Creators can set challenges, run private lobby tournaments, or highlight community made theories about optimal routes and mind games. That content feeds discovery on social platforms and brings new players into the loop who then create their own stories. A virtuous cycle forms where play leads to clips which lead to more play.

Lightweight tech and fast onboarding

The game runs on modest hardware and loads quickly, which matters for a platform with many mobile users. Controls are familiar and tutorials are implicit, so the first five minutes are focused on action rather than instruction. This reduces churn and keeps the funnel healthy. For parents and guardians, the readability of rounds and clear objective structure make it easier to supervise and discuss healthy play habits.

Why it endures

Longevity in social games comes from trust. Players trust that a session will be fun, that progress will feel meaningful, and that returning after a break will not leave them lost. MM2 delivers on all three fronts. The round structure is timeless, cosmetics and trading provide long arcs, and events act as simple reentry points. Newcomers can learn the basics in a single evening while veterans keep finding new ways to surprise friends.
